Fifth report on human rights of the United Nations Verification Mission in Guatemala

The "Fifth Report on Human Rights of the United Nations Verification Mission in Guatemala" serves as a critical examination of human rights conditions in Guatemala, focusing on the socio-political landscape following decades of civil strife. This meticulously documented report employs a blend of empirical data and qualitative assessments, reflecting the United Nations' ongoing commitment to monitoring human rights amid the complex interplay of local and international influences. Written in a formal and analytical style, the report situates Guatemala within the broader context of post-conflict reconciliation, highlighting both progress and ongoing violations of fundamental rights, thus contributing significantly to the discourse on human rights in Latin America. The United Nations and its Verification Mission have played a pivotal role in promoting peace and stability in Guatemala since the end of civil conflict in the 1990s. This particular report draws upon the extensive expertise and commitment of international and local stakeholders dedicated to fostering sustainable development and democracy in the region. The synthesis of firsthand testimonies and statistical evidence reveals the multifaceted challenges the nation faces, informed by the UN's mandate to support human rights governance and accountability. Readers concerned with human rights advocacy, international relations, and Latin American studies will find this report essential not only for its content but also for its historical significance. As a nuanced and comprehensive assessment, this report encourages ongoing discourse about the importance of international oversight in promoting and protecting human rights in vulnerable contexts, making it a valuable addition to any academic or policy-oriented library.
